In late 2018, Steve Bannon, previously a top aide to Donald Trump, visited the UK preparing for a speech at the Oxford Union.

The event was disrupted by numerous protesters, and Bannon, scheduled to travel that night, told Jeffrey Epstein in an email: "Protesters delayed my talk I doubt I can make the plane we r enroute to the airport".

Epstein replied: "That. Is a gulf air that leaves at 9:50 with a layover in Bahrain". Bannon replied: "You are an excellent assistant".

These exchanges were released on this week alongside over 20,000 documents from the records of Epstein, the late financier convicted of sex crimes.

The disclosure by the House oversight committee includes an iMessage chat where Bannon's identity is redacted. Media outlets has been able to establish his involvement by cross-referencing the timeline, events, and locations mentioned.

For instance, Epstein talks about chartering a jet from the UK for the unnamed individual in the messages, and commends their "address at Oxford". Bannon took part in the News Xchange conference on 14 November, and gave the speech at the Oxford on November 16.

Bannon, who faces no allegations of any wrongdoing, did not reply on the request for comment.

Bannon served as Trump's key aides in the lead-up to the presidential election and during the initial phase of his presidency, but resigned from the White House in August 2017.

He has acknowledged he was making a documentary about Epstein prior to his death and allegedly has approximately 15 hours of recordings. In a live taping of his show recently, he stated: "We plan to publish the film, the multi-part documentary, next year - at the start of next year."

But the newly released documents suggest Bannon's relationship with Epstein extended than documenting his life, with the disgraced financier occasionally seeming to act like a aide.

A short time before the conversation in which Epstein seemed to arranged a private plane for Bannon, Epstein remarked: "how does it feel to have the most highly paid travel agent in the world ".

Bannon expressed gratitude: "You are pretty good assistant", to which Epstein responded "Therapies. Excluded".

Discussing a trip to "AD" in a separate text, Epstein told Bannon: "I'll make sure you are well looked after."

British Affairs Mentioned in Messages

The published messages also reveal Bannon and Epstein talking about UK politics in that year.

Earlier on the same day his speech at the Oxford Union, Bannon messaged Epstein: "I've gotten pulled into the Brexit thing this day with Farage, Johnson and Rees Mogg."

Then, in what seems like a reference to the UK prime minister, the embattled British leader at the time, he continued: "The guys are attempting to move on. may soon…"

Epstein suggested Bannon: "In my view staying as much as you can in the UK. Best-- so people see the dedication of your follow through."

Shortly after, Epstein inquired: "Will Theresa may remain in power". Bannon replied: "It seems unlikely however the guys over here have little courage" and noted "Boris ; Michael Gove; Rees Mogg; Davis - someone has to take charge".

Theresa May was eventually removed in 2019 after withstanding two votes of no confidence in late 2018.

A spokesman for the political party told the BBC: "Nigel Farage has not been in a meeting with Bannon, Jacob Rees Mogg and Boris Johnson." And there is nothing to suggest such a meeting took place.

The US House of Representatives will decide next week on whether the Department of Justice should make public all its files related to its investigation into Epstein, who passed away in jail in that year.

Attention in Epstein's relationships with influential individuals was reignited this week after the release of over 20,000 documents from his estate.

Some of those mentioned Trump, who has consistently denied any impropriety. The president was a friend of Epstein's for a long time, but claims they fell out in the early 2000s, a couple of years prior to Epstein was first arrested.
